    Note: The wood he uses in his groups is SPECIAL..  Bloody dangerous stuff, but nice and hard to get...

    Often used in gun grips and knife handles  :-)  

    Care must be used when cutting Cocobolo, as the woods oils can induce allergic reactions if inhaled or exposed to unprotected skin and eyes. A dust collection system, coupled with the use of personal protective equipment such as respirators, is highly recommended when machining this wood.
